10.2 Voltage Protection Module VPM
Danger to life through electric shock when using third-party motors
VPM can be used with third-party motors. If, when using third-party motors, the VPM does
not limit the DC link voltage, this can result in death or severe injury.
• Please observe the following when using third-party motors:
Danger to life through automatic start of the drive
An uncontrolled automatic start of the drive can result in fatal accidents.
• Take precautions against an automatic start of the drive.
NOTICE
Damage when using motors that are not short-circuit proof
Use of motors that are not short-circuit proof in conjunction with a Voltage Protection
Module can result in their destruction.
• Only use motor that are short-circuit proof.
Fire hazard due to overheating because of inadequate ventilation clearances
Inadequate ventilation clearances can cause overheating with a risk for personnel through
smoke development and fire. This can also result in more downtimes and reduced service
lives of components.
• Maintain the 200 mm clearances above and below the components.
NOTICE
Damage to devices as a result of incorrect connecting cables
Using incorrect connecting cables for Voltage Protection Modules can damage the
connected components.
• Use shielded MOTION-CONNECT 800PLUS motor cables, type 6FX8.
